A state-wide orange alert has been activated in Jharkhand, signaling the imminent threat of heavy to very heavy rainfall. Citizens are being advised to take all necessary precautions as the weather department forecasts significant precipitation. Potential impacts include water accumulation in urban and rural areas, along with possible disruptions to daily routines. Disaster management agencies are working closely with local authorities to manage the situation and ensure the safety and well-being of all residents during this period of intense weather.
